    Mainly, I have seen the words "Moore", "Signed" and "limited".

    But yes, I liked Neonomicon a lot. Because indeed the key word here is "disturbing" and I am not used to that feeling when reading comics. But I like to be surprised. I don't see it as porn (in the sense of something made to arouse its reader) but true horror comic, and something else (it is indeed something else all together). But I only read it once and episodically and I will probably have clearer thoughts once I re read it in collected form, after re reading The Courtyard (the stories are linked). As it is a Lovecraftian thingy I am not sure that everything in this work has to make sense.
